Transaction 5996f002756e93213d564229182e6c292e1dc4096f15dab71fa974bc530194fe

1 Input
2 Outputs
  • 5996f002756e93213d564229182e6c292e1dc4096f15dab71fa974bc530194fe:0
  • value  337585674
    address  3HdTPPedhLF2gHW47JukWt6tusAyn8GCGG
  • 5996f002756e93213d564229182e6c292e1dc4096f15dab71fa974bc530194fe:1
  • value  1195780
    address  1KPctQzsygdaJKoRtYNW22J11XGJBnhJ2w